Abstract

VARGAS CHANES, Delfino  and  GONZALEZ NUNEZ, José Carlos. The effect of institutions on Latin American economic growth. Perf. latinoam. [online]. 2018, vol.26, n.51, pp.329-349. ISSN 0188-7653.  https://doi.org/10.18504/pl2651-013-2018.

The aim of this article is to identify relevant characteristics of institutions that have an effect on economic growth in selected Latin American countries. A multilevel model was used for this propose, the dependent variable is the real per capita GDP, and the explanatory variables are indicators of governance provided by the World Bank. The results show that the significant variables are regulatory quality and control of corruption. This implies the need to strengthen the institutions of the rule of law, voice and accountability, political stability and absence of violence, and government effectiveness.

Keywords : Economic growth; institutions; governance; regulatory quality; control of corruption and multilevel model.
